Annular Ball BearingSpecial Features:
W/or w/o felt core seals
Properties:
A cylindrical device in which the inner or outer ring turns upon a single or double row of hardened balls which roll easily between the two rings, thus minimizing friction. For items with faces specially ground for duplex mounting see bearing, ball, duplex. Excludes bearing, ball, airframe.
